“Bastards” come to Westeros in the latest featurette
The promotion for Game of Thrones season 4 is really ramping up now. First the “Artisans: Shooting in Belfast” featurette was released yesterday, and now another new video exploring season 4 is making the rounds.
“Bastards of Westeros” examines the roles of illegitimate offspring in the Seven Kingdoms, particularly those born to the nobility, such as Jon Snow, Gendry, Ramsay Snow, and Ellaria Sand. In addition to the discussion of a bastard’s life, viewers are treated to several new clips from season 4, including the introduction of Ellaria Sand at the royal wedding, Ramsay and Roose’s tense relations (along with Roose presenting his bride Walda), and Tyrion and Bronn interrupting a brothel visit of the Dornish newcomers.
The video features interviews with George R.R. Martin, Kit Harington, Iwan Rheon, Indira Varma, and executive producers David Benioff and D.B. Weiss.
